Can't give you a definitive answer on your contract issue as I don't have a copy, but on balance, I would prefer my mobile company to discontinue the service if the pattern of calls was strange and from overseas rather than have a £1000 bill to settle. I trust you would concur.
May I also ask why you didn't get a local sim to tide you over and contact Vodafone USA to get then to reconnect you via internal links to Voda UK.
I also ensure that my network is aware if I am going abroad as I was previously cut off by Orange when in Bulgaria.
You have to see that they are in a lose-lose situation and there are some recent posts complaining about networks NOT cutting off stolen sims when the calling patterns changed.0 -
